The Impact of Poor Air Quality in Manufacturing
Manufacturing operations, including cutting, grinding, sanding, and welding, produce fine dust and fumes that remain suspended in the air. Long-term exposure to these contaminants can cause respiratory issues, skin irritation, and long-term health hazards such as lung disease. Dust buildup on equipment can also result in inefficiencies, frequent maintenance, and expensive downtime.
Without effective air filtration, such problems can increase, affecting worker morale and compliance with regulations. Numerous industries have to comply with Occupational Safety and Health Administration (OSHA) regulations, which makes air quality solutions such as the Dustbox necessary.
